I am using sql server 2008. I have taken full backup of my database. Its backup file file (.bak) is around 750 MB. Sql Server is installed on c drive which contains 5 GB free space. When i try to restore my database it get following error :
Restore failed for Server 'FQA2008'. (Microsoft.SqlServer.SmoExtended)
ADDITIONAL INFORMATION:
System.Data.SqlClient.SqlError: There is insufficient free space on disk volume 'C:\' to create the database. The database requires 12304515072 additional free bytes, while only 5931470848 bytes are available. (Microsoft.SqlServer.Smo)

Question: I dont understand that my bak file size is just 750 MB and how does it takes 12 GB of space for restoring database?
